APPENDIX M viii <br />• SMALL AREA EXEMPTION # 2 - SAE Z 3 <br />LOMA LOADOUT SURFACE WATER CONTROLS <br />To control the runoff of water and sediment from the loadout, a <br />berm has been constructed on the south side of the area. In <br />accordance with applicable regulations, these calculations will show <br />that the sediment containment structures are capable of retaining <br />the entire volume of the design storm. <br />The loadout is a strip of Land up to ?5 feet wide. The area that <br />drainage must be controlled is about 1300 feet long. The slope of <br />the area is about 2% down from the track to the berm on the south <br />side. Water will be retained up to one foot high in the detention <br />area that is about 300 feet long. <br />SPECIFICATIONS <br />Area = 97,500 sgft = 2.24 acres Ave Slope = 2~ <br />Soil Type = mixed use Group = C <br />Length = 200 ft Veg. cover = 0~ <br />PEAK FLOW CALCULATIONS <br />1. From "Peak Flows In Colorado" Pio = I.4" <br />Z. Runoff: CN disturbed use CN = 87 <br />• RUNOFF IO yr Pe= 0.47"' <br />3. For Area =,10 acre & Slope = 2~ Slope Adj. Factor = 1.20 <br />4. Assume that Actual Area = Equivalent Area <br />Therefore, Actual area/Equivalent Area = 1.00 <br />5. For CN =87 and Area = 2.24 ac Oa is about 2.8 cfs/inch <br />6. Equivalent discharge qio = Z.8#0.47"#I.ZO = 1.58 cfs <br />7. The ACTUAL DZSCHARGfi is: Qio = 1.58 cfs <br />8. The VOLUME DISCHARGED is: Vio = 0.47"# 97,500ft/12 <br />Vio = 3,818 tuft <br />SIZE OF THE SEDIMENT TRAP <br />The detention area is triangular in cross section 1 foot high and <br />50 feet wide and 300 feet long. <br />The Volume of the Trap = 0.5 * base * height * length <br />Volume = 0.5 * 50' * 1' * 300' = 7,500 cubic feet <br />The trap will retain the entire volume of a IO year, 24 hour <br />precipitation event. <br /> <br />M(viii) - 2 6/28/91 <br />
